There are many home jobs that can be easily completed by yourself, but tree removal is not really one of them. Removing a tree could be a unsafe task which is preferably left to a tree pro.
Chain saws are not a straightforward tool to operate. They often have a fair amount of kick back which might cause severe injuries and lost limbs. A qualified tree service is experienced and insured to deal with this kind of job.
How to know you need to remove a tree
There are an assortment of signs that can let you know a tree should be cut down.
Damage to half of the tree
When there is extensive damage to half or greater of the tree that is visible from the ground it is a good indication that you might want to have it taken out.
Primary trunk is split
When the trunk of the tree is cracked or broken vertically, it weakens the tree significantly, and it ought to be removed. Vertical fissures can additionally be a sign that there is decomposition inside the tree.
A large branch has broken
If a larger branch or limb has split off from the tree, this will likely result in severe decomposition and weaken the tree substantially. It may be a good idea to have it removed.
Dead Roots
Dead, broken down, or decomposing roots will cause a tree to become unstable, lean and fall over. This can become hazardous and it is a wise idea to take out the tree.
Tree is Leaning
When a tree is leaning over, it is at risk of falling down, and may be hazardous. Falling into a structure, telephone pole, street, or onto a person can be a serious issue. Safety and security should always be a primary consideration.
Dead Trees
Dead trees can quickly become infested with pests such as termites, rats, ants, and wood boring bugs. This infection can rapidly spread to your home, and other nearby trees or structures. It’s a good idea to have a dead tree removal company cut out the tree prior to it causing more damages.
